linux 搜索文件名中非,Linux笔记:查看和搜索文件内容

本文讲一些查看文件内容的常用方法,以及在文件中搜索关键字的常用方法,但是注意,这些方法都不能编辑文件内容,编辑文件内容需要vi、vim等编辑器来进行。

注释

在配置文件或shell脚本中,一行中井号#之后的内容为注释,而不是有效的配置设置或代码。

cat命令

cat [-n] 文件名:显示文件内容,但是它会自动地不停显示每一页,最后停留在最后一页,对于文件内容较多的文件这个命令就不适用了(除非你就是想看文件末尾的内容)。-n选项用于显示行号。

这个命令反过来写tac,则执行效果就是反的,即从末尾开始显示并停留在最开始的一页,但是此时就不支持-n选项了。

more命令

more 文件名:分页显示文件内容。

进入浏览页面后,可使用如下操作:[空格]:下一页。

b:上一页。

[Enter]:换行。

q:退出。

注:与more相应的,还有一个less命令,它的功能更强大,more支持的操作它都支持,并且还支持搜索等操作。

head命令和tail命令

head/tail [-n num] 文件名:默认显示前或末尾十行,如果指定了-n选项,则显示前或末尾num行内容。

grep命令

grep [选项] 查找内容 文件:在文件中查找,并将文件中包含查找内容的行列出来。

选项:-i:不区分大小写。

-n:输出行号。

-v:排除指定内容。如“grep -v ^# /etc/inittab”表示查找文件中非#开头的行,^表头以……开头。

--color=auto:搜索出的关键字用颜色显示。

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值